Zynq USBデバイステスト (ファームウェア)
Zynq USBデバイステスト (PC側ソフトウェア)の続き。
C:\Xilinx\SDK\2014.1\data\embeddedsw\XilinxProcessorIPLib\drivers\usbps_v2_0 のexamplesに対するパッチ。 usbMain関数を呼び出すと動作開始。examplesのファイル達はusbフォルダにコピーされたものとする。
概要としては、examplesはUSB mass storageとして動作するので、バルク転送のTX/RX割り込みがかかるところを 横取り(XUsbPs_HandleStorageReqをコメントにする)して、所望のデータ処理に置き換える。 また、サンプルはTX割り込みがかからないようになっているので、TXのビットをorして有効にする。
